Set in the charming town that spawned the eau-de-vie, this friendly festival has existed since 1994 in the heart of the city’s public gardens. The 7-hectare gardens are a combination of the property of the hotel Otard de la Grange and the hotel Dupuy d’Angeac. They are gorgeously designed by the landscape architect Edouard André.About Cognac Blues Passions Festival
Cognac Blues Passions is considered an ecologically sustainable festival, so volunteers spend the whole festival cleaning up and making sure the gardens remain pristine.
Waste is also sorted out in different bins while dry toilets are set up for your disposal.
The glasses at the festival are tracked with a small deposit.
You get your coin back any time you return the cup to the place you purchased your drink.
Cognac city is situated on both sides of the Charente river and is a graceful, historical place with many old sites such as the Valois castle, the Saint-Jacques gateway and the Saint-Léger church.
There’s also the Château of Cognac, home to the company Otard Cognacs since 1795.
The Château is open to the public for visits and tastings.
In the Perrin de Boussac mansion, the Arts of Cognac museum chronicles the history of the liqueur and its production process.

Except for Exit Festival, Serbia has one more festival in the fortress.
Nis fortress, in southern Serbia, dates from 1723.
A period when the Turks ruled over the city and the area.
Nisville Jazz festival venue is in the city’s centre, surrounded by hotels, restaurants, tourist info centre, bus stations etc.
Each year Nišville jazz festival attracts 100.000 visitors with legendary guests such as the saxophonist Grace Kelly or Solomon Burke, who attended the festival in the past.
Nis is 235 km from the country’s capital Belgrade, 155 km from Sofia, Bulgaria, and just over 200 km from the Macedonian capital of Skopje.
From all three of these cities, you can come by bus and train to visit Nišville.

Edinburgh Jazz Festival is presenting high-quality musicians from all over the world.
The shows are held at many venues around town. Most of them are easily accessed within the city centre.
Edinburgh is well-known as a festival city.
In August, there are six significant festivals alone.
The skyline is dominated by the world-famous Edinburgh Castle, which sits on its perch on Castle Rock, looking down over the city.
This historic fortress offers a magnificent point to view Edinburgh and its surroundings.
The Medieval Old Town and the Georgian New Town form a World Heritage Site. Both are beautiful places to stroll around and take in the architectural styles of the historical buildings.

– A Festival just for Funk Music
More than 4,000 people come to enjoy some of the best soul and funk music in the south of Spain.
Said to be the only festival in Europe dedicated only to funk music.
.
Dance til daylight with great artists.
Live DJ sets play tribute to funk originators between bands to keep the crowd grooving without interruption at The Bullring stage.
Explore the enchanting festival grounds for lively activities fitting for all ages.
BY PLANE
The nearest airport is Granada. From Granada, it’s 150 kilometres to Torres.
BY TRAIN
Direct trains from Madrid and Seville to Jaen. From Jaen, it’s 31 kilometres to Torres.
BY CAR
The primary access to Torres is the J-3230 road, which connects with A-320 ManchaReal – Jódar in the section between Mancha Real and Jimena.
The road from Mancha Real will have posters of the festival for guidance.
The festival area is 3,5 kilometres from Torres centre.
Camping on the festival grounds is a good option, but finding a hotel nearby may be more comfortable.
A shuttle bus service use to be available from the beginning to the end of the festival.
Buses will leave from the following stations: La Yuca, Mancha Real, Linares, Bailén or Mengibar.

Travel around 30 km west of Lisbon on the A5, and you’ll reach the charming coastal town of Cascais.
The EPD Cool Jazz festival is held in the Hipódromo Manuel Possolo and the Parque Marechal Carmona.
It’s an easy drive from Lisbon or Lisbon Airport, and you also have the option of taking a bus or train.
Situated on the Estoril coast, west of Lisbon, Cascais is famous as a holiday destination and a day trip from the nation’s capital Lisbon.
